// This function is based on Christer Ericson's code and description of the 'Uniform Grid Intersection Test' in
|
||||||
|
// 'Real Time Collision Detection'. The following information from the errata on the book website is also relevent:
|
||||||
|
//
|
||||||
|
// pages 326-327. In the function VisitCellsOverlapped() the two lines calculating tx and ty are incorrect.
|
||||||
|
// The less-than sign in each line should be a greater-than sign. That is, the two lines should read:
|
||||||
|
//
|
||||||
|
// float tx = ((x1 > x2) ? (x1 - minx) : (maxx - x1)) / Abs(x2 - x1);
|
||||||
|
// float ty = ((y1 > y2) ? (y1 - miny) : (maxy - y1)) / Abs(y2 - y1);
|
||||||
|
//
|
||||||
|
// Thanks to Jetro Lauha of Fathammer in Helsinki, Finland for reporting this error.
|
||||||
|
//
|
||||||
|
// Jetro also points out that the computations of i, j, iend, and jend are incorrectly rounded if the line
|
||||||
|
// coordinates are allowed to go negative. While that was not really the intent of the code — that is, I
|
||||||
|
// assumed grids to be numbered from (0, 0) to (m, n) — I'm at fault for not making my assumption clear.
|
||||||
|
// Where it is important to handle negative line coordinates the computation of these variables should be
|
||||||
|
// changed to something like this:
|
||||||
|
//
|
||||||
|
// // Determine start grid cell coordinates (i, j)
|
||||||
|
// int i = (int)floorf(x1 / CELL_SIDE);
|
||||||
|
// int j = (int)floorf(y1 / CELL_SIDE);
|
||||||
|
//
|
||||||
|
// // Determine end grid cell coordinates (iend, jend)
|
||||||
|
// int iend = (int)floorf(x2 / CELL_SIDE);
|
||||||
|
// int jend = (int)floorf(y2 / CELL_SIDE);
|
||||||
|
//
|
||||||
|
// page 328. The if-statement that reads "if (ty <= tx && ty <= tz)" has a superfluous condition.
|
||||||
|
// It should simply read "if (ty <= tz)".
|
||||||
|
//
|
||||||
|
// This error was reported by Joey Hammer (PixelActive).
